"Karpura Valli"
Macro shot of "Karpura Valli" leaf. Coleus Ambonicus or Karpura Valli (Tamil), is a medicinal plant that has a flavor of camphor (Karpuram in Tamil means camphor).This plant has been used in South India for medicinal purposes (cold, cough, indigestion) a very long time.
Since the leaves of this plant is succulant, I find it great subject for macro shots. I find the patterns of veins in the leaves ("venation") fascinating. This particular plant is a great subject for this study.
